These four characters hail from the Silver Marches (an area in the northwest of the continent Faerun), in or near a small hamlet named Sefildhir. The community consists mainly of humans, elves, and half-elves and sits near a densely wooded area in the northern portion of the North Woods, merely a couple of days' travel from from Citadel Felbarr in the Rauvin Mountains. To its west is the larger town of Quaevarr, which itself is just north of the metropolis Silverymoon.
At the onset of the campagin, a town hall meeting is held because merchant caravans to and from Sefildhir have been under attack from goblin raiders. Several traders have lost their lives, and caravans have been pillaged and/or destroyed by this sudden aggression from the goblins. Our four adventurers agree to pose as merchants in an attempt to lure the goblins into attacking. The operation is successful, as a trio of goblins and their dog companions attempt to ransack the "caravan," only to be defeated by the party. One of the goblins escapes, but leaves a trail of blood which the party is able to track towards the goblin camp. Along the way, they battle some wolves which attack them in the dense forest. As they work their way closer to the mountains and the land around them becomes hilly and sparse, they stumble upon the camp. Rorin's animal companion, Knid, sets out to scout about the camp, but the monsrous spider is spotted by two patrolling guards and is forced to retreat to the party, at which point a battle ensues. A quartet of goblins, a hobgoblin warrior, and a hobgoblin mage are the only inhabitants of the camp at the time, indicating another series of raids in progress. That said, after a lengthy and dangerous battle, the party emerges victorious. They loot the camp and put it to the torch. However, some of the loot provides a potentially alarming situation, which has them returning to town to consult their resident employer, Lord Wilfred du Schnozzle.
Upon returning to Lord du Schnozzle, the party discusses the loot they found. A pair of scrolls and a pair of potions, which normally wouldn't be much cause for concern, were found with the insignia of the nebulous Red Wizards. This magocratic organization is led by a number of powerful wizards, each of whom have different philosophies on how to run their nation of Thay. While Thay itself is very far away, the Red Wizards have a presence all over the continent, as they establish trading enclaves with countless towns and cities near and far. Through these enclaves, they produce potions, scrolls, and mundane items to trade. However, it is suspected that some of the more conquest-oriented members of this organization may be establishing the means to mass an unstoppable army of mages whose power can rule all of Faerun. The party seeks to find out how these goods fell into the hands of the goblins. Were they simply claimed as bounty from a previous caravan raid? Or have the Red Wizards of the Silver Marches entered into a nefarious agreement with the goblin horde which has become increasingly bold and aggressive in their raids in recent months?
At the start of the next sesesion, they will begin their journey to Quaevarr, where the nearest Red Wizard enclave stands.
